The Artistic Treasures of the Oratory

The Oratory of the Gonfalone is a treasure trove of 17th-century art. Its most striking feature is the coffered wooden ceiling, a magnificent work of carving and gold decoration completed in 1643 by French sculptor Leonardo Scaglia. This intricate ceiling is a testament to the craftsmanship of the era and provides a stunning visual backdrop to the space. Reddit

Beyond the ceiling, the walls are adorned with a coherent cycle of canvases dedicated to the life of the Virgin Mary, painted by Francesco Bastari. These works offer a narrative journey through key moments in her life. The altar features the 'Annunciation' by Antonio Viviani, also known as 'il Cieco' (the Deaf), a student of the renowned Federico Barocci. This particular piece was commissioned by Francesco Stelluti, a significant figure from Fabriano and a founder of the Accademia dei Lincei, adding a layer of historical and scientific connection to the art. Access and Community Engagement

Visiting the Oratory of the Gonfalone often requires a bit of local knowledge and flexibility. Unlike many museums, it's not always open on a fixed schedule. Instead, access is frequently tied to special exhibitions or available upon request. This means planning ahead is key for a successful visit. Reddit

Community members and visitors have shared success stories of gaining entry by simply asking. In one instance, the priest of the adjacent cathedral was able to open the doors, providing not only access but also a historical narrative. This highlights the importance of engaging with locals and inquiring about possibilities. Reddit
